Clock Setup
The Timer functions that turn power on at the specified time
do not work unless the clock has been adjusted. Be sure to
adjust the clock first.
Press MENU to display the Menu screen.
Press \/| to select “Setup”.
Press '/" to select “Clock setup”, and press OK.

NOTE
• The time you set is automatically updated via Teletext time
information.
■ Backup
The clock function is maintained for about 10 minutes even
when the AC adapter has been shut off due to a power
outage or when moving the LCD TV set. (Since about 30
minutes are required to charge the backup power supply, it
may not be possible to maintain the clock function if the
charging time is excessively short.)

Timer Functions
You can set “Sleep timer” and “Wake-up timer” to automati-
cally turn off and on the LCD TV set.
Perform steps 1 and 2 in Backlight and Power Setting
to display the Features Menu screen.
• The Timer functions Menu screen can be displayed directly by
pressing TIMER.
Press '/" to select “Timer functions”, and press OK.
Press '/" to select the desired item, and press OK.

NOTE
• When you set “Wake-up timer”, the STANDBY/ON indicator lights
up orange while in the standby mode.
• Be sure to adjust the clock with “Clock setup” in the Setup Menu
screen before setting “Sleep timer”, “Alarm” or “Wake-up timer”.
• The time is automatically set/corrected via the Teletext broadcast
when available.
• The “Channel” setting for “Wake-up timer” changes in the following
order: TV (0-159)* → AV1 → AV2 → FM radio (0-39)*.
* The skipped channels cannot be selected.
• You can output the picture and sound of the external device with
the “Wake-up timer” function. Make sure that the external device
turns on at the time you specified.
• When not using the LCD TV set for a long period of time, either
turn off the main power or set “Wake-up timer” to “Off”.
• When “Wake-up timer” has been set to “On”, the LCD TV set is
turned on at the set time every day until it is set to “Off”.
• Always make sure to turn off the power with the remote control.
“Wake-up timer” will not be activated if the main power is turned off
with   (MAIN POWER) on the LCD TV set.
• You can check the time set in “Wake-up timer” by pressing
 (Status Display).
• When the time set for the “Wake-up timer” is reached when the
power is on, the LCD TV set changes to the set channel. The
sound volume does not change at this time.

Child Lock
Important:
• Please refer to page 45 for “IMPORTANT NOTE ON DISENGAGING
ADVANCED CHILD LOCK”.
The Child Lock function blocks the viewing of any channel for
which the child lock has been set.
To use the Child Lock function, you first need to define your
PIN (Personal Identification Number).
[1] Defining a PIN
Press MENU to display the Menu screen.
Press \/| to select “Features”.
Press '/" to select “Child lock”, and press OK to
display the PIN input screen.
